First Pickup I've Owned

The Frontier surprised me in the fact that it did't feel like a truck when I drove it. I needed a truck for yard projects and towing my motorcycles and the Nissan Maxima couldn't do that. I knew I was giving up comfort, looks and some bells/whistles for a pickup truck but the ride, style of some of the features of the Frontier impressed me enough that I purchased it. I really like my truck so far!

Better MPG than before!!

I have owned this truck for almost a month & 750 miles. The increased fuel mileage is definitely a welcomed increase over the outgoing powertrain. Truck is very comfortable! My only problem is a vibration at 67+ MPH; I think it is in the driveshaft or rear differential. I will be taking it back to Nissan soon & hoping for the best.

Failed transmission at 000,115 miles.

It's a great car, or was. Our other car is a 2012 Xterra and the frontier was a nice refresh of an upgrade. The transmission skipped a gear on the freeway and all sorts of codes got thrown with a jerky ride back home. The dealer still can't figure out what's wrong and they've never seen the codes before. Still in the midst of the problem and trying to get it resolved.

GOOD TRUCK, POOR WORKMANSHIP

I have owned over 20 trucks in my lifetime. This one rides good, and handles pretty good too. A little bit wishy washy steering, and it feels like it doesnt track as well as others. But, my biggest complaint is with the warranty. I only have 5000 miles on my truck, and the first time I took it to the dealer for warranty, I was not very happy! There was not much paint on the bottom of the tailgate when it was opened. After showing it to the dealer, and the dealer saying it was "normal", I escalated it to Nissan. All they did was refer me back to the selling dealer, and they never did anything about it.....unreal.....I took it back in today for some minor issues, but again was told that the things I mentioned were "normal"........the drivers vent pushes hot air out when the floor vents are selected......I could not believe that they claim this is "normal".......I wonder how many people would be turned off from buying if they knew that........ridiculous really....

it's a good truck, liked

This truck rides good, but the electronic part disappoint me, the dashboard is antiquate, they said it has Apple Play, but it doesn't, unable to transfer my apps like GPS to the car screen, only one USB, Bluetooth, it's ok, my small Ford Transit has much advanced electronics.
